The BlueRibbon Coalition (BRC), a leading advocate for responsible management of recreation on public lands, was invited in a formal letter by Senator Jeff Bingaman–Chairman of the Senate Committee on Energy–to testify at the committee hearing. “The purpose of the hearing is to receive testimony regarding off-highway vehicle management on public lands,” stated Chairman Jeff Bingaman (D-NM) in his letter.
“I am honored to have received the invitation to speak before the Senate Committee,” said Mumm. “This is an important time for access interests, and this is a tremendous opportunity for the BlueRibbon Coalition to ensure that the enthusiast voice is heard in Washington, D.C.” The Committee’s hearing is scheduled for Thursday, June 5, 2008, at 9:30 a.m. in room SD-366 of the Dirksen Senate Office Building.
The BlueRibbon Coalition is a national recreation group that champions responsible use of public and private lands, and encourages individual environmental stewardship.
